a {
color:#8d0101;
}

a:hover {
text-decoration:underline;
color:#8d0101;
}

body {
color:#8d0101;
}

#c {
background:#fcffb5;
width:676px;
margin-top:0;
}

#n {
width:224px;
}

#n a {
color:#FFFFFF;
}

#wrapper {
background:url(../images/franchiseGrad3.gif) repeat-y;}

#franchiseNav {
background:#af0202;
height:30px;
padding-top:10px;
text-align:center;
margin-bottom:30px;
color:#ffffff;
}

#franchiseNav a {
color:#FFFFFF;
}

#franchiseFooter {
background:#434343;
height:30px;
padding-top:10px;
text-align:center;
color:#ffffff;
}

#franchiseFooter a {
color:#ffffff;
}

#franchiseBody {
margin-left:51px;
margin-bottom:30px;
min-height:300px;
margin-right:51px;
}

* html #franchiseBody {
height:300px;
}

#franchiseLinkArea {
text-align:right;
margin-right:51px;
}

#franchiseTitle {
margin-left:51px;
margin-top:15px;
font-size:19px;
}

* html #franchiseTitle {
margin-top:20px;
}

.franchiseTeacher {
}

.franchiseTeacherImage {
border:5px solid #000000;
}

.franchiseTeacherName {
font-weight:bold !important;
}

.franchiseTeacherTitle, .franchiseTeacherName {
margin-bottom:10px;
}

.franchiseSchool {
float:left;
margin-right:20px;
margin-bottom:20px;
width:245px;
background:#434343;
padding:10px;
color:#FFFFFF;
}

#franchisePageTitle {
font-size:190%;
margin-bottom:30px;
}

.franchiseSchoolLabel {
float:left;
width:50px;
font-weight:bold;
}

.franchiseSchoolInput {
float:left;
}

.franchiseSchoolName {
text-transform:uppercase;
font-weight:bold;
}

.franchiseAppForm {
font-size:15px;
font-weight:bold;
margin-bottom:20px;
}

.franchiseContactLabel {
width:100px;
float:left;
font-weight:bold;
font-size:16px;
}

.franchiseContactInput {
float:left;
font-size:16px;
}

.franchiseContactArea {
margin-bottom:10px;
}

#franchiseImage {
border:5px solid #000000;
}

.adminLabel {
width:100px;
float:left;
margin-bottom:10px;
}

.adminInput {
float:left;
margin-bottom:10px;
width:200px !important;
}

#franchiseAdminBody {
margin-left:51px;
margin-bottom:30px;
min-height:300px;
margin-right:51px;
}

* html #franchiseAdminBody {
height:300px;
}

#adminLoginError {
margin-top:20px;
}

.adminHeading {
margin-bottom:10px;
padding-bottom:0;
}

#franchiseAdminBody h2 {
margin-bottom:20px;
}

.adminInputBtn {
margin-top:10px;
}

.adminBorder {
width:100%;
height:1px;
background:#434343;
margin-bottom:20px;
margin-top:20px;
}

.adminTeacherBorder {
width:100%;
height:1px;
background:#434343;
margin-bottom:20px;
margin-top:20px;
}

.adminImage {
display:block;
margin-bottom:10px;
}

.adminTeacherArea {
background:#E9E9E9;
padding:10px;
color:#737373;
}

.adminImageLabel {
width:100px;
float:left;
margin-bottom:10px;
margin-right:20px;
width:300px;
}

.adminImageInput {
float:left;
margin-bottom:10px;
}

.adminImageUpload {
margin-bottom:5px;
}

.adminTeacherImage {
display:block;
margin-bottom:10px;
}

.adminTeacherInfoArea {
margin-bottom:5px;
}

.adminBtn {
padding-top:3px;
}

#franchiseMainContent {
float:left;
}

#franchiseMainImage {
border:5px solid #000000;
margin:5px 20px 20px 20px;
}
